Neymar met with Brazil teammates ahead of Paraguay clash


Brazilian superstar Neymar reunited with his national team colleagues ahead of the crucial qualifying match against Paraguay. He shared photos from the meetup on his Instagram Stories.
The forward posted pictures with Raphinha and Marquinhos, captioning them, “Great to see you, brother. Good luck today ❤️ @raphinha” and “Missed you, Mokot 😂😂😂 Love you and have a great game.”

It's worth noting that Neymar was not named in Brazil’s squad for these fixtures, as he has only recently recovered from injury. Additionally, he was diagnosed with coronavirus just a few days ago, though that didn't stop him from joining the team.
Meanwhile, Brazil secured a 1-0 victory over Paraguay in their home qualifier thanks to a goal from Vinícius. This win guaranteed the Seleção a place at the 2026 World Cup.

Neymar missed almost the entire current qualifying campaign, playing only in the first four matches. During those appearances, he proved invaluable—scoring twice and providing three assists.
